BBC BASIC has been implemented on many platforms, starting with the BBC Micro in 1981 and initial development on the Acorn System. So far I know of implentations on eleven CPUs on more than 40 platforms. It has also been implemented in portable C that can be compiled on almost any platform with a C compiler. In this part of my site I aim to catalogue, document and make available copies or links to copies of all different implementations of BBC BASIC on all platforms. Richard Russell has written a brief history of BBC BASIC. BBC BASIC is not a BBC emulator, it is an implementation of the BBC BASIC programming language.
